VIDEO: Benghazi Talking Points Crossed the Line of Politics and National Security

We agree. Politics took precedent [1] over answering crucial questions about national security and American foreign policy, along with accounting for the deaths of four Americans in the fatal and deadly attack on the U.S. consulate in Benghazi, Libya.